To the release manager: I'm passing ownership of the Pellwick deep-link router to Sorrel before the 4.2 cut. The intent-matching table now lives in the Farrowgate config service; stale entries were purged last sprint. Watch the fallback route — it silently swallows malformed slugs, which inflated our drop-off metrics in March. The staging resolver needs its keystore unlocked before each regression pass, and that keystore accepts only one credential. For the signing vault, the recovery phrase is noted directly below.

recovery phrase for tafog-fafog: novix-novdor-fraath-brieth-olieth-oliix-rusix-wenion-julax-druox

Subject: Schema registry cut-over complete

Team,

The cut-over from the legacy Eventhold registry to Schemavault finished last night. All producers on the Larkfield cluster now register against the new endpoint. Old registry is read-only until month end, then gone. If a customer reports serialization failures, check their client points at Schemavault, not Eventhold. Escalate anything weirder to the platform channel. The active production configuration for Schemavault is below.

service settings:
[aldion]
port = 9000
team = jormir
host = aldion.qirvannet.example
region = west-3
access_code = ac_f790c7
timeout_ms = 5000

Notes, ops sync — Alert dedup (Quellbird)

Discussed the Quellbird deduplicator swallowing distinct alerts that share a fingerprint prefix. Agreed to widen the hash window and add a bypass tag for paging-critical alerts. On-call should not silence duplicates manually until the fix ships Thursday. Questions during the interim window go directly to the engineer accountable for Quellbird, named below.

signatory, bahop-hafog: Frawyn Silion Julath